Настройка Firefox для анонимности
FireFox - один из лучших браузеров для тонкой настройки, скорее всего многие со мной будут согласны, но не все знают о такой приблуде, как about:config
Если кратко - это утилита, распологающая в себе правила, отвечающие за работу firefox'а (доступ сайтов к геоданным, телеметрии и многое другое), сегодня я поделюсь своими аддонами и попробуем настроить firefox для безопастного серфинга в сети, начнем:
(Всё проделано в firefox quantum версии 61.0.1 (64))
Вводим в адресную строку: Код:
about:config
Поскольку правил тут действительно много - будем пользоваться поиском:
Для начала уберем отправку отчетов:
Код:
breakpad.reportURL - сотрите значение browser.tabs.crashReporting.email - сотрите значение browser.tabs.crashReporting.emailMe - значение: false browser.tabs.crashReporting.sendReport - false datareporting.healthreport.infoURL - сотрите значение datareporting.healthreport.uploadEnabled - false datareporting.policy.dataSubmissionEnabled - false extensions.getAddons.cache.enabled - false security.ssl.errorReporting.automatic - false
Теперь местоположение:
Код:
browser.geolocation.warning.infoURL - сотрите значение browser.search.countryCode - поставьте любую страну (дефолт: RU, у меня US) browser.search.geoip.url - сотрите значение browser.search.geoip.timeout - значение: 0 browser.search.geoSpecificDefaults.url - сотрите значение browser.search.geoSpecificDefaults - false browser.search.region - поставьте любую страну (дефолт: RU, у меня US) browser.search.suggest.enabled - false geo.enabled - false geo.wifi.uri - сотрите значение
Убираем доступ к аппаратным устройствам(камеры, микрофоны и т.д.):
Код:
dom.gamepad.enabled - false dom.gamepad.non_standard_events.enable - false dom.imagecapture.enabled - false dom.presentation.discoverable - false dom.presentation.discovery.enabled - false dom.presentation.enabled - false dom.presentation.tcp_server.debug - false media.getusermedia.aec_enabled - false media.getusermedia.agc_enabled - false media.getusermedia.audiocapture.enabled - false media.getusermedia.browser.enable - false media.getusermedia.noise_enabled - false media.getusermedia.screensharing.enabled - false media.navigator.enabled - false media.navigator.permission.disabled - false media.navigator.video.enabled - false media.video_stats.enabled - false media.webspeech.recognition.enable - false dom.netinfo.enabled - false media.webspeech.recognition.enable - false media.webspeech.synth.enabled - false
Отправка данных на сервера mozilla и google(must have):
Код:
browser.safebrowsing.downloads.enabled - false services.sync.prefs.sync.browser.safebrowsing.downloads.enabled - false browser.safebrowsing.downloads.remote.block_dangerous_host - false browser.safebrowsing.downloads.remote.block_dangerous - false browser.safebrowsing.downloads.remote.block_potentially_unwanted - false browser.safebrowsing.downloads.remote.block_uncommon - false browser.safebrowsing.downloads.remote.enabled - false browser.safebrowsing.downloads.remote.url - оставьте пустым browser.safebrowsing.malware.enabled - false services.sync.prefs.sync.browser.safebrowsing.malware.enabled - false browser.safebrowsing.provider.google.gethashURL - false browser.safebrowsing.provider.google.lists - false browser.safebrowsing.provider.google.reportURL - сотрите значение browser.safebrowsing.provider.google.updateURL - сотрите browser.safebrowsing.provider.google.updateURL - сотрите browser.safebrowsing.provider.mozilla.lists - сотрите browser.safebrowsing.provider.mozilla.updateURL - сотрите browser.safebrowsing.reportPhishURL - сотрите services.sync.prefs.sync.browser.safebrowsing.malware.enable - false
Синхронизация и другая хурма:
Код:
identity.fxaccounts.auth.uri - сотрите services.sync.engine.addons - false services.sync.engine.bookmarks - false services.sync.engine.history - false services.sync.engine.passwors - false services.sync.engine.prefs - false services.sync.engine.tabs - false services.sync.fxa.privacyURL - сотрите services.sync.fxa.termsURL - сотрите
Телеметрия:
Код:
dom.ipc.plugins.flash.subprocess.crashreporter.enabled - false dom.ipc.plugins.reportCrashURL - false network.allow-experiments - false security.ssl.errorReporting.enabled - false toolkit.crashreporter.infoURL - сотрите значение toolkit.telemetry.archive.enable - false toolkit.telemetry.cachedClientID - сотрите toolkit.telemetry.rejected - true toolkit.telemetry.server - сотрите toolkit.telemetry.unified - false
Отключаем WebRTC:
Код:
media.peerconnection.enabled - false media.peerconnection.ice.default_address_only - false media.peerconnection.ice.relay_only - true media.peerconnection.identity.enabled - false media.peerconnection.identity.timeout - 1 media.peerconnection.turn.disable - true media.peerconnection.use_document_iceservers - false media.peerconnection.video.enabled - false
Опции отключения автоматического обновления браузера
Код:
app.update.auto = false app.update.enabled = false app.update.mode = 0
Опция отключения автоматического обновления поисковых плагигов
Код:
browser.search.update = false
Опции отключения отправки данных о производительности Firefox
Код:
datareporting.healthreport.service.enabled = false datareporting.healthreport.uploadEnabled = false datareporting.policy.dataSubmissionEnabled = false
Отключает статистику использования
Код:
toolkit.telemetry.enabled=false
Опция отключения возможности подключения Firefox к сторонним серверам (Telefonica) без разрешения.
Код:
loop.enabled=false
Опция отключения cтороннего сервиса для управления списком статей, отложенных для прочтения.
Код:
browser.pocket.enabled=false
В отличие от всех перечисленных выше, эту опцию, наоборот, следует включить. Это нужно для активной блокировки сайтов, которые известны своим некорректным поведением в отношении слежки за пользователями. Не путать с DNT, которая только «просит» сайты не отслеживать вас. Здесь же осуществляется принудительная блокировка.
Код:
browser.search.suggest.enabled=tru
Отключение отслеживания действий на сайте
Код:
browser.send_pings - false
Отключение прямого ДНС запроса
По умолчанию стоит false то есть отключено. Если вы пользуетесь TORом или прокси, то в этом случае браузер будет делать запрос к ДНС не напрямую, а через прокси
Код:
network.proxy.socks_remote_dns - true
Отключить WebGL.
Код:
webgl.disabled в true. dom.enable_performance = false dom.battery.enabled = false network.dns.disablePrefetch = true network.http.accept.default = text/html,application/xhtml+xml,application/xml;q=0.9,*/*;q=0.8
Отключить кэширование в Firefox
Код:
network.http.use-cache= false browser.cache.offline.enable= false browser.cache.disk.enable= false browser.cache.disk_cache_ssl= false browser.cache.memory.enable= false network.http.keep-alive.timeout = 600 network.http.max-persistent-connections-per-proxy = 16 network.cookie.lifetimePolicy = 2 network.http.sendRefererHeader = 0 network.http.sendSecureXSiteReferrer = false network.protocol-handler.external = false [Включаем все подпарамеры в значении false] network.protocol-handler.warn-external = true [Включаем все подпарамеры в значении true] network.http.pipelining = true network.http.pipelining.maxrequests = 8 network.http.proxy.keep-alive = true network.http.proxy.pipelining = true network.prefetch-next = false browser.cache.disk.enable = false browser.cache.offline.enable = false browser.sessionstore.privacy_level = 2 browser.sessionhistory.max_entries = 2 browser.display.use_document_fonts = 0 dom.battery.enabled = false intl.charsetmenu.browser.cache = ISO-8859-9, windows-1252, windows-1251, ISO-8859-1, UTF-8 extensions.blocklist.enabled = false network.proxy.no_proxies_on = (пусто) по умолчанию localhost, 127.0.0.1
Cookie или Куки - если вы хотите быть невидимым для статистики, не хотите быть опознанным сайтом,то вам придется отключить куки в браузере. Отключать полностью не стоит, так как на подавляющем большинстве сайтов вы будете себя чувствовать не уютно и некоторые функции просто не будут работать. Но если вам надо посетить некий ресурс "без следов" то в Firefox есть прекрасный инструмент - это Приватный просмотр. Подключить его можно в любой момент. Инструменты - Начать приватный просмотр
С about:config на этом все, дальше обсудим расширения, которые я считаю обязательными для установки(если покажется попсовым - прошу прощения, вдруг кто-то не знает)
1) HTTPS Everywhere - утилита блокирует http запросы для предотвращения утечки данных через незащищенный протокол.
2) User-Agent Switcher - подменяет user agent на выбранный пользователем, доступны все самый популярный платформы (даже мобильные). Хорошо подходит для вбива разных площадок ( Раньше с ним били брут Ebay )
3) uBlock Origin - просто адблок с фильтрами, блэк джеком и ... ну вы поняли
4) FoxyProxy Standart - в firefox есть функция добавления прокси, но мне кажется эта штукенция удобнее
5) Web Developer - редактор куки, отключение css, и другие утилиты для web разработчика
6) NoScript - хардкорное расширение, название символизирует
Наши услуги: @GOdayBot
Внимание!!! Вся Информация на канале "0-day | Уязвимость 0-го дня" для ознакомления, не несёт в себе призыва к чему-либо, автор не несёт никакой ответственности. 18